The present invention generally relates to devices for assisting individuals with limited flexibility or dexterity. The invention particularly relates to a device for assisting an individual when donning or removing a sock, shoe, or other garment from their feet.
Individuals with limited flexibility or dexterity may experience difficulties when leaning forward or bending to the side to don or remove a sock, shoe, or other garment from their lower extremities, such as their feet. While various devices have been produced to address these issues, there is an ongoing demand for improved devices capable of assisting individuals in these activities.
The present invention provides devices suitable for assisting individuals with limited flexibility or dexterity when attempting to don or remove a sock, shoe, or other garment from their lower extremities.
According to one aspect of the invention, such devices include a base comprising a longitudinal central section, two flanges along oppositely-disposed longitudinal sides of the central section, and oppositely-disposed distal and proximal ends. The central section and the flanges define a trough that is open at the distal and proximal ends and along a longitudinal side of the base opposite the central section. A handle is coupled to and extends from the base. The handle is rigid and comprises arms attached to the base and a crossmember that connects the arms.
According to another aspect of the invention, a method of using the device described above includes placing the sock over the base by inserting the distal end of the base through an opening of the sock, continuing until the sock covers at least a portion of the base, the opening of the sock is near the proximal end of the base, a toe of the sock is near the distal end of the base, and the sock encloses at least a portion of the trough formed by the central section and flanges of the base, donning the sock by inserting a foot of the individual through the opening of the sock near the proximal end of the base and, while the sock and the opening thereof are held open by the central section and the flanges of the base, passing the foot through the opening of the sock and through the trough formed by the central section and flanges of the base until the sock is fully on the foot, and the removing the base from between the sock and the individual so that the sock remains on the foot.

During use, a sock (not shown) may be placed over the base 12 by inserting the distal end 22 through the opening of the sock, and continuing until the sock covers at least a portion and more preferably most of the base 12, the opening of the sock is near the proximal end 24 of the base 12, and the toe of the sock is near the distal end 22 of the base 12. In so doing, the sock also encloses at least a portion of the trough formed by the central section 18 and flanges 20 of the base 12. Thereafter, an individual may don the sock while it is installed on the base 12 by inserting their foot through the opening of the sock near the proximal end 24 of the base 12, and while the sock and its opening are held open by the central section 18 and flanges 20 of the base 12. In this process, the individual's foot passes through the opening of the sock and through the trough formed by the central section 18 and flanges 20 of the base 12 until the sock is fully on their foot, after which the base 12 can be removed from between the sock and the individual's leg so that the sock remains on their foot. Although the invention will be described hereinafter in reference to donning a sock with the device 10 shown in the drawings, it will be appreciated that the teachings of the invention are more generally applicable to other types of applications, such as, but not limited to, devices for donning shoes and other garments adapted to be placed on or around an individual's leg or foot.
The drawings represent the base 12 of the device 10 as formed by multiple adjacent planar portions that form the central section 18 and flanges 20, although other configurations are foreseeable. Preferably, the base 12 is tapered and sized such that the size of the opening of a sock installed on the base 12 is determined by the location of the sock on the base 12. As noted previously, the handle 14 comprises two arms 26 that are attached to the flanges 20 of the base 12 at the proximal end 24. The crossmember 28 of the handle 14 can be employed as a grip portion connecting the two extension arms at ends thereof opposite the base 12. The arms 26 are preferably attached to the oppositely disposed flanges 20 of the base 12 in order to not create an obstruction to the opening of the trough at the proximal end 24 of the base 12, as well as promote an even distribution of the weight of the base 12 on the handle 14. It is foreseeable that the handle 14 and the base 12 may be integral components, or separate individual components coupled by any suitable means, such as but not limited to welding or fasteners.
During use, the handle 14 provides an individual with an extended reach such that the base 12 and a sock located thereon may be placed near their foot with less bending and/or leaning than would otherwise be necessary. Preferably, the handle 14 is a rigid body in order to promote ease of control when donning a sock with the device 10. The crossmember 28 of the handle 14 may be oriented transverse to a longitudinal axis of the base 12, the arms 26, and/or the opening of a sock during use of the device 10 to further promote ease of use. As shown by the embodiment in the drawings, the flanges 20 of the base 12 have rounded or chamfered edges adjacent the distal and proximal ends of the base 12 to reduce the likelihood of damage to the sock and/or injury or discomfort to the individual during use.
If included, the stand 16 is preferably capable of removably coupling with handle 14 and holding the base 12 in an upright position (relative to a surface such as ground or a floor) in order to allow an individual to pick up the device 10 with limited bending or leaning.
